Familiarizing yourself with common legal terms related to bus accidents can help you better understand your case. Below are definitions of important concepts frequently encountered during the legal process.
Negligence refers to the failure to exercise reasonable care, resulting in harm to another person. In bus accident cases, negligence may involve actions by the bus driver, maintenance staff, or other parties responsible for safe operation.
Damages are the monetary compensation sought for losses suffered due to the accident. This includes medical expenses, lost income, pain and suffering, and property damage.
Liability is the legal responsibility for the accident and resulting injuries. Identifying liable parties is crucial to pursuing a successful claim.
A settlement is an agreement reached between parties to resolve the claim without going to trial. Settlements often provide faster resolution and compensation.

Immediately after a bus accident, prioritize your safety and seek medical attention even if injuries seem minor. It is important to report the accident to the police and obtain a copy of the police report. Gathering information such as photos of the scene, contact details of witnesses, and documentation of your injuries will be valuable for your case. Avoid discussing fault or making statements to insurance adjusters without legal advice to protect your rights.
Fault in bus accident cases is determined by evaluating all available evidence, including witness statements, traffic laws, and the conduct of involved parties. Investigations focus on whether the bus driver, company, or another party failed to exercise reasonable care. Comparative negligence laws in California may also affect fault allocation if multiple parties share responsibility. Establishing fault is essential for pursuing compensation and requires careful legal analysis.
Yes, you can file a claim even if you were partially at fault for the accident. California follows a comparative fault system, meaning your compensation may be reduced by the percentage of your responsibility. It is important to have legal counsel to accurately assess fault and protect your interests. A qualified attorney will work to minimize your liability and maximize your recovery despite shared fault.

In California, the statute of limitations for personal injury claims typically requires filing within two years of the accident date. Failing to file within this timeframe may result in losing your right to seek compensation. It is important to consult with a legal professional promptly to ensure all deadlines are met and your claim is preserved.

Important evidence for a bus accident claim includes police reports, medical records, photographs of the accident scene and injuries, witness statements, and any available video footage. This evidence helps establish liability and the extent of damages. Collecting and preserving such information early on strengthens your claim and supports effective legal advocacy.
Many personal injury lawyers, including those handling bus accident cases, work on a contingency fee basis. This means you do not pay upfront legal fees and only owe payment if your case is successful. This arrangement allows you to pursue your claim without financial strain. When a bus is operated by a government agency, additional legal procedures and notice requirements may apply. Claims against government entities often have shorter filing deadlines and require specific documentation. Legal guidance is essential to navigate these rules effectively and protect your right to compensation. Your attorney will assist in meeting all obligations and pursuing your claim properly.
